In the second of a series of videos on tips for success, we spoke to Josh Eggleton, chef patron of the Michelin-starred Pony & Trap pub, and fish and chips restaurant Salt & Malt in Chew Magna, director of Yurt Lush Cafe, and regular BBC Great British Menu contestant. 

Along with his sister Holly, Josh Eggleton runs the Michelin-starred Pony & Trap, a 200-year-old pub near Bristol, with a strong emphasis on locally-sourced produce and a proud list of suppliers from across the neighbouring counties of Cornwall, Devon, Dorset, Somerset, Wiltshire and Gloucestershire. Having won its Michelin star in 2011, the pub has kept to this high standard ever since. 

Dishes focus on high-end pub favourites such as ham hock with leek, or snacks such as quail's scotch egg and steak tartare, plus bold cuts of meat and fresh fish, with original takes on classics such as sticky ale pudding, and caramel eclair. 

With a burgeoning media career including regular appearances on professional-level shows such as the BBC's Great British Menu, Eggleton's career has included work in the kitchens at Chanterelle in New York, and The French Laundry in California. 

We caught up with him at this year's Restaurant Show in London Olympia to ask him his secrets of success...
